Spinning beachball in Mountain Lion Mail - HELP !!

Macbook Pro running Mountain Lion


Mail is full screen and has a spinning beachball - I cant minimise the screen - I can swipe to bring up the desktop or anyother program, however whenever I go back to Mail I get the beachball.


So - I have done a 'Force Quit'


When I reopen Mail it defaults immediately to the full screen and then seconds later the spininng beachball starts.


I have done a full restart, Mail starts up the same way with the same problem.


I have held the power button in and done a PRAM reset - I still get it opening up the same way.


I've been to Disk Utility and done the verify and repair disk but the utility finds no problems, therfore nothing to repair. I'm running out of ideas!


Help!

MacBook Pro (15-inch Mid 2009), OS X Mountain Lion (10.8.4), 8Gb ram

Maybe the mail preferences are corrupt. You could try:

  1. Go back to disk utility and repair preferences.
  2. if you have a Time Machine backup, you could reinstall the preferences from a backup when it was working.The way you do this is
    1. hold down the option key
    2. in the Go menu in the Finder, scroll down to Library
    3. in Library, go to Containers/com.apple.mail/Data/Library/Preferences and select the folder Preferences.
    4. then you go into Time Machine, select the backup, and it will navigate to that Preferences folder, and you tell it to replace the current folder with the backup version. If you have changed any preferences since that backup, you will have to redo your changes if you want them.
  3. If you don't have a time machine backup, you could do the option key-Go menu trick, go to Library/Containers/com.apple.mail/Data/Library/Preferences and find and drag the file com.apple.mail.plist to the trash, and then restart. You will have to reenter your preferences.
  4. if that doesn't work, I'd try reinstalling OSX over your previous installation. Perhaps overkill but I bet it would fix the problem.

If arthur's suggestions don't work -


Quit the application.

Hold down the option key while using the Finder Go To Folder command. Enter ~/Library/Caches/com.apple.mail

Move the folder to your desktop.

Open the application and test. If it works okay, make sure your mail is there, and then delete the folder from your desktop.

If the application is the same, return the folder to where you got them from, overwriting the newer ones.

If you prefer to make your user library permanently visible, use the Terminal command found below.
